Handover — Lift Maintenance, Saturday

For the facilities desk: Corvex Elevators are on site Saturday from 07:00 to service lifts 1 and 3 at Tallowgate Plaza. Lift 2 remains in service. Their crew will need escorting to the motor room on the roof; the stairwell door self-locks behind you. Sign them in as usual and log start and finish times. The roof door uses the code below.

turnstile pass: bdg-KUDKL-55212

### Runbook: Report export timezone mismatches (Glimmerfield)

If a customer reports that exported totals differ from the dashboard, check whether their report schedule predates the March cutover — older schedules still render in server-local time rather than the account timezone. Re-saving the schedule fixes it. Before escalating, confirm the export worker is running with the expected timezone settings shown below.

config for kadup-kajog:
[raldor]
host = raldor.tolvaqworks.internal
user = raldor_svc
database = raldor_prod

Subject: DR drill Friday — sqlint config restore

New team members: Friday's disaster-recovery drill includes restoring the Fennelworks lint server that enforces our SQL file rules. During the drill, pushes with unformatted SQL will be rejected by the fallback linter. Run the local checker before committing. Don't disable rules to get through; flag false positives in the drill channel. The fallback linter's config store is sealed until the drill starts. Unseal it with the recovery passphrase below.

recovery phrase for fawif-tajeg: norael-aldmir-casir-brivan-ulaion